What does an Assistant Project Manager Civil Engineer do?

An Assistant Project Manager Civil Engineer supports the planning, coordination, and execution of civil engineering projects such as roads, bridges, and infrastructure developments. They assist the project manager with tasks like scheduling, budgeting, communication with stakeholders, and ensuring project milestones are met. Their role often includes managing documentation, coordinating with contractors and suppliers, and helping to resolve issues that arise on-site. This position is key to keeping projects organized and running smoothly while ensuring compliance with safety and quality standards.

What are the most common challenges faced by Assistant Project Manager Civil Engineers when coordinating between the office and field teams?

Assistant Project Manager Civil Engineers often encounter challenges in ensuring effective communication and coordination between office staff, field crews, and subcontractors. Balancing project documentation, schedule updates, and real-time site issues requires strong organizational skills and adaptability. It's common to address discrepancies between project plans and on-site realities, requiring quick decision-making and problem-solving. Developing strong relationships with both the design and construction teams helps in resolving conflicts and maintaining project momentum.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Assistant Project Manager Civil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Assistant Project Manager Civil Engineer, you need a solid background in civil engineering principles, project management, and construction processes, typically supported by a relevant engineering degree and EIT or FE certification. Familiarity with project management software (such as MS Project or Primavera), AutoCAD, and construction documentation systems is highly valuable. Strong organizational, communication, and problem-solving skills help you coordinate teams, manage timelines, and resolve on-site issues effectively. These skills and qualities are essential for ensuring projects are completed safely, on schedule, and within budget while maintaining high-quality standards.

What is the difference between Assistant Project Manager Civil Engineer vs Civil Engineer?

AspectAssistant Project Manager Civil EngineerCivil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's degree in Civil Engineering; often some project management trainingBachelor's degree in Civil Engineering; licensure varies by region
Work EnvironmentSupports project management teams, coordinates between stakeholders, oversees daily site activitiesDesigns, plans, and analyzes civil engineering projects; may supervise construction
Employer & Industry UsageConstruction firms, engineering consultancies, infrastructure projectsDesign firms, construction companies, government agencies

The Assistant Project Manager Civil Engineer primarily supports project execution and coordination, working closely with project managers, while Civil Engineers focus on designing and planning civil infrastructure. Both roles require a civil engineering background, but their responsibilities and daily tasks differ significantly.
